Need help about floating bridge from Guitarists.
Hello people..
I am going out of country for approximately 2.5 months. I have an Ibanez RG350EX guitar and it has a floating bridge. I won't be able to take it with me so I was wondering what is the best way to keep/store it. I was thinking about removing the strings and the bridge, but was not sure about it as I don't have much experience with removing the bridge. I am sure I can do it, but I am scared I might screw up something. I don't want to warp the neck of my guitar or damage it in any way. Can you guys suggest something? I can't leave this guitar with anyone (everyone is going out for vacation) Thanks!

I'm pretty sure the best thing you can do for a floating bridge is never take all the strings off all at once. Unless theres something wrong with the truss rod or the guitar in general it should be absolutely fine. Just store it in it's case flat. Maybe put some silica gel in with it too.
With a normal guitar I would loosen the strings off but not with a floating bridge.
